According to SolarWinds
's latest financial reports the company has $0.28 B in cash and cash equivalents.
A companyโs cash on hand also refered as cash/cash equivalents (CCE) and Short-term investments, is the amount of accessible money a business has.
Year | Cash on Hand | Change |
---|---|---|
2023-12-31 | $0.28 B | 94.27% |
2022-12-31 | $0.14 B | -79.67% |
2021-12-31 | $0.73 B | 170.44% |
2020-12-31 | $0.27 B | 56.14% |
2019-12-31 | $0.17 B | -54.69% |
2018-12-31 | $0.38 B | 37.77% |
2017-12-31 | $0.27 B | 167.95% |
2016-12-31 | $0.10 B |
